Hannibal Barca |
Passion or Profession: Military Commander
Period: 247–182 BC
Hannibal was a military commander in ancient Carthage, which today is located inside Tunisia. He is best known for marching with his army over the Pyrenees and the Alps to battle the Romans. Though he and his armies were eventually defeated and forced to retreat, they did enjoy many successes for a period of about two years. Today Hannibal is still remembered alongside other great military commanders, such as Alexander the Great.
